解决Clash配置不成功的全面指南

引言

在现代网络环境中,Clash作为一款强大的网络代理工具,广泛应用于科学上网和网络加速。然而,许多用户在使用Clash时,常常会遇到配置不成功的问题。本文将深入探讨这一问题的原因及解决方案,帮助用户顺利配置Clash。

什么是Clash?

Clash是一款支持多种协议的网络代理工具,能够帮助用户实现网络流量的智能分流。它的主要功能包括:

  • 科学上网:突破网络限制,访问被屏蔽的网站。
  • 流量分流:根据不同的规则,将流量分配到不同的代理服务器。
  • 性能优化:提高网络连接的稳定性和速度。

Clash配置不成功的常见原因

在使用Clash时,用户可能会遇到以下几种配置不成功的情况:

1. 配置文件格式错误

  • 配置文件的格式不符合YAML规范。
  • 缺少必要的字段,如proxiesrules等。

2. 代理服务器不可用

  • 代理服务器地址错误或服务器宕机。
  • 代理协议不支持或配置错误。

3. 网络环境问题

  • 本地网络防火墙阻止了Clash的连接。
  • ISP(互联网服务提供商)限制了代理流量。

4. Clash版本问题

  • 使用的Clash版本过旧,可能不支持某些新功能。
  • 不同平台的Clash版本存在差异,导致配置不兼容。

如何解决Clash配置不成功的问题

针对上述常见原因,以下是一些解决方案:

1. 检查配置文件

  • 确保配置文件符合YAML格式,可以使用在线YAML校验工具进行检查。
  • 确认配置文件中包含必要的字段,并且字段名称拼写正确。

2. 验证代理服务器

  • 检查代理服务器的地址和端口是否正确。
  • 使用其他工具(如curl)测试代理服务器的可用性。

3. 调整网络设置

  • 检查本地防火墙设置,确保Clash能够正常访问网络。
  • 尝试更换网络环境,使用不同的ISP进行测试。

4. 更新Clash版本

  • 定期检查Clash的更新,确保使用最新版本。
  • 如果在特定平台上使用Clash,确保下载与平台兼容的版本。

FAQ(常见问题解答)

Q1: Clash配置文件的基本结构是什么?

A1: Clash的配置文件通常包括以下几个部分:

  • proxies:定义可用的代理服务器。
  • rules:定义流量分流规则。
  • port:设置Clash的监听端口。

Q2: 如何导入配置文件?

A2: 在Clash的界面中,通常可以找到“导入配置”选项,选择本地的配置文件进行导入即可。

Q3: Clash支持哪些代理协议?

A3: Clash支持多种代理协议,包括但不限于:

  • HTTP
  • SOCKS5
  • Shadowsocks
  • Vmess

Q4: 如果配置不成功,是否会影响其他网络应用?

A4: 是的,如果Clash配置不成功,可能会导致所有通过Clash代理的网络应用无法正常访问互联网。

结论

在使用Clash时,配置不成功是一个常见的问题,但通过仔细检查配置文件、验证代理服务器、调整网络设置以及更新Clash版本,用户通常能够顺利解决这些问题。希望本文能为您提供有价值的帮助,让您更好地使用Clash。

正文完
 0